hi all, i have '92 325i 2.5L V6. The other day started leaking antifreeze, i kept on driving it to the house, and then an oil pressure gauge came on and the car died on the highway. after letting it to cool down i couldm't start it anymore. i checked the oil and it was dry. i added oil but it still wont start now. does it sound like bad news? internal engine damage?
oh yeah it cranks, but it just wont fire up anymore. cranking is strong too. and i never did an upgrade either. dont leak oil either. but when i drove it overheated it all dissapeared....
Its done. You got it so hot the head warped/cracked and all the oil coolant mixed and probably most went out the tail pipe. Start looking for another engine or car cause to get an M50 properly rebuilt with as many new parts as yours is going to need is going to cost at least a few grand.

First of all get the car checked by a mechanic. I think we're all pretty confident on our assessment that your engine will need to be replaced. However, diagnosing these things over the internet can be iffy. Have a professional look at it.
If you are going for an engine swap, do not put in the engine from a 318. Well, at least I recommend against that. It is a great engine, but you will have to go through some trouble to mount the engine properly, only to end up with a lot less power and torque. A six-cylinder from another 325, a 328, or an M3 would be easier.
